#d96ec4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d96ec4 is composed of 85.1% red, 43.1%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 49.3% magenta, 9.7%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 311.8 degrees, a saturation of 58.5% and a lightness of 64.1%. #d96ec4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ffdcff with #b30089.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

#d96ec4 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#d96ec4 has RGB values of R:217, G:110, B:196 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.49, Y:0.1,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14249668.

Hex triplet d96ec4 #d96ec4
RGB Decimal 217, 110, 196 rgb(217,110,196)
RGB Percent 85.1, 43.1, 76.9 rgb(85.1%,43.1%,76.9%)
CMYK 0, 49, 10, 15
HSL 311.8°, 58.5, 64.1 hsl(311.8,58.5%,64.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 311.8°, 49.3, 85.1
Web Safe cc66cc #cc66cc
CIE-LAB 61.561, 52.929, -26.196
XYZ 44.154, 29.892, 55.666
xyY 0.34, 0.23, 29.892
CIE-LCH 61.561, 59.057, 333.668
CIE-LUV 61.561, 55.984, -48.362
Hunter-Lab 54.673, 48.48, -22.095
Binary 11011001, 01101110, 11000100

Shades and Tints of #d96ec4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0309 is the darkest color, while #fefafd is the lightest one.

Tones of #d96ec4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a89fa6 is the less saturated color, while #fc4bd9 is the most saturated one.
